A top university in the United Kingdom has reportedly slapped a content warning on the Bible, saying it contains "graphic bodily injury and sexual violence," including the Crucifixion.
Students studying English literature at the University of Sheffield in Sheffield, England, are given guidance that alerts them about the Gospels, especially, according to details of the guidance reported by The Mail on Sunday .
The University of Sheffield, which was recently ranked one of the top universities in the U.K. by The Guardian University Guide 2026, emphasized to The Christian Post that the content note is not intended to treat the Bible differently than other texts or to prevent discussion on it.
